How they compare

Yemen currently reports 710,386 one-year-olds against 494,487 one-year-olds in China, a difference of 215,899 one-year-olds.

That makes Yemen's figure about 1.4 times China's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 41 shared years of data; in 1983 it was China ahead.

China ranks 10th and Yemen ranks 8th of 194 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, China averaged higher in 3 and Yemen in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ade China Yemen Difference Ahead
1980s 3.91 million one-year-olds 414,806 one-year-olds 3.50 million one-year-olds China
1990s 3.02 million one-year-olds 327,337 one-year-olds 2.69 million one-year-olds China
2000s 1.73 million one-year-olds 250,130 one-year-olds 1.48 million one-year-olds China
2010s 178,709 one-year-olds 392,686 one-year-olds 213,978 one-year-olds Yemen
2020s 221,326 one-year-olds 617,350 one-year-olds 396,024 one-year-olds Yemen

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
